When Your Home Needs More Than Its Panel Can Handle

Many homes in Atwater were built decades ago when electrical demands were a fraction of what they are now. Adding air conditioning, upgraded appliances, home offices, or electric vehicle chargers often exceeds the capacity of original panels. Even without adding major loads, older panels degrade over time—connections loosen, breakers wear out, and components become less reliable. A panel change addresses both capacity limitations and aging infrastructure before either causes a power failure or safety issue.
